#1c64e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c64e2 is composed of 11% red, 39.2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 49.8%. #1c64e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#38c8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1c64e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c64e2 has RGB values of R:28, G:100,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1860834.

Shades and Tints of #1c64e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020711 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c64e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7f80 is the less saturated color, while #085ff6 is the most saturated one.
